I researched diff covers for my 2007 F250. I ended up with the OEM cover that came out in 2008. It was finned cast aluminum and better than my OEM stamped steel.
I saw several videos where the aftermarket covers would actually hurt lubrication due to the shape. The OEM cover is designed to "splash" fluid up and around to the front side to lubricate the pinion side. Many aftermarket covers did not do this.
Be careful with what you buy.

So to clarify some information here. The whole Banks testing is on a rear diff cover that was flat. The cover that I’m using is clearly not flat and it shape is very close to OEM. Aeration was what banks was talking about and it has to do with a flat back cover. Not applicable.
Having the drain plug is fantastic and they claim a significant reduction in temps. I plan on using an infrared laser to try to get a baseline and some before / after info.
I also have the PPE deep transmission pan and I see an average of 14° drop in transmission temps vs OEM.
